    1. Accomack County Virginia Births
    2. Darlene Coleman
    3. 1853-1865 Celistia Payne 2 Dec. 1860 white female Ira Payne Emily Payne page 70 1866-1873 George Payne 23 Mar.1870 white male Ira ???? Emily Payne page 169 Ira Payne 11 Jan 1872 white male Ira EmoryPayne page 201 1874-1877 Ira Payne 6 Jan1874 white male Not Legible Emily Payne page 229 NO NAME Payne 10 Dec.1877 white male Peter Payne Mary Payne page 278 Not Legible Payne 7 Dec.1875 white male Ira Payne Emily Payne page 251 1882-1892 James Payne 18 June 1884 white male Edward Payne Mollie Payne page 391 John Payne Oct.1889 white male Nathaniel Payne Malinda Payne page 522 Lesie Payne 16 Nov. 1890 white male William Payne Bessie Payne page 546 Martha & Mary 1 Dec.1886 white females( twins) Peter Payne Mary Payne page450 No Name Payne (TWINS) 25 Dec1888 white male Charles Payne Airy Payne page 485 1893-1896 Maggie Payne 11 Oct 1893 white female William Payne Bettie Payne page 621 Willie Payne 10 Jan.1896 white male Edward Payne Florida??? page 704

    1. ELIZABETH "BETSY" PAYN(E) GUDGEL
    2. Linda Gudgel Finnell
    3. I am searching for information on my elusive ancestor, Elizabeth "Betsy" PAYN(E) GUDGEL, b. October 3, 1763 (maybe in PA or KY), d. December 2, 1823 Gibson Co., IN, buried Gudgel Family Cemetery, Owingsville, Gibson Co., IN. Elizabeth is said to have been a widow with young children when she married the second time to Andrew GUDGEL/GUDSHALL October 5, 1793 in Woodford Co., KY. The original marriage bond in Woodford Co. spells Elizabeth's name as PAYN. Andrew and Elizabeth left KY about 1810 and settled in Indiana Territory (later Knox Co., then Gibson Co.). He had children and so did she and they all went to Indina together. There were 3 children born in KY of this marriage also. Questions: Who was the PAYN(E) husband of her first marriage ? It is said her maiden name was PAUL but I have not found any evidence to document that. What became of her PAYN(E) children in Indiana? Any leads or comments would be appreciated.
